4to, pp. xviii, [ii], [9]-372 + 5 folding maps and 16 lithographic plates. Modern blue quarter morocco, blue cloth boards, spine lettered plainly in gilt. Toned, a little dustsoiling, some foxing to edges of plates.
The posthumous second edition of the major work of the historian Robert Stuart (1812-1848), 'well regarded in its day' (ODNB), produced after his untimely death from cholera by his brother-in-law David Thomson (1817-1880), a professor of natural history at Aberdeen.
